Chlorophytum comosum Variegatum, commonly known as the Spider Plant, is a tender, herbaceous perennial grown for its lush and variegated foliage. It features short, bright green leaves with a cream margin as it grows to 20 cm tall and 30 cm wide. Chlorophytum comosum Variegatum is commonly grown indoors in a container though it can be grown outdoors in frost-free areas. In these situations, it is often included in borders, planted around outdoor living areas, mass planted as a groundcover, or planted alongside a path.

Stromanthe Triostar is a popular indoor plant owing to its lush and colourful foliage. It features elegant, dark green, pink, and cream-coloured leaves and grows compactly to about 50 cm tall and 40 cm wide. Stromanthe Triostar makes for a wonderful office and house plant and is great for bringing colour and joy to a space.
